Allen Schaefer Obituary

Allen Schaefer

Allen P. Schaefer, 53, of Belleville, Ill., born May 2, 1957, in Belleville, Ill., passed away Sunday, Aug. 15, 2010, at St. Elizabeth's Hospital, Belleville, Ill.

Allen was a life member of St. Mary's Catholic Church in Belleville, Ill. He attended St. Mary's School and graduated with the class of 1971. He graduated from Belleville West High School in 1975. Allen was a member of Boy Scout Troop 3 at St. Mary's and received his Eagle Scout Award with his twin brother Stephen on Feb. 3, 1974. They were the first set of twins in the Belleville Okaw Valley Council to receive this award.

Allen worked as the enamel specialist at the Peerless Stove Company in Belleville for more than 30 years. He was a member of the Boilermakers Union Local 363 and Belleville Swansea Moose Lodge 1221. Allen's passions were gardening and spending time with his family. He was a selfless son, brother, uncle and friend to all he knew.

Allen was preceded in death by his father, Marcellus Schaefer; and a brother, Jerome G. Schaefer.

Surviving are his mother, Ruth, nee Emig, Schaefer of Belleville, Ill.; his twin brother, Stephen J. (Angie) Schaefer of Belleville, Ill.; his brother, Paul (Debra) Schaefer of Kirkwood, Mo.; a nephew, Bradley Schaefer of Kirkwood, Mo.; three nieces, Renee Schaefer of Kirkwood, Mo., Melissa Schaefer of O'Fallon, Mo., and Beth (Neal) Miller of House Springs, Mo.; a great-nephew, Brennan of O'Fallon, Mo.; and a great-niece, Liliana Marie of O'Fallon, Mo.

In lieu of flowers, memorials may be made to St. Mary's Catholic Church or to the Boy Scouts of America Troop 3 at St. Mary's in Belleville, Ill. Condolences may be expressed to the family online at www.rennerfh.com.

Visitation: Friends may call from 4 to 8 p.m. Wednesday, Aug. 18, 2010, and from noon to 1 p.m. Thursday, Aug. 19, 2010, at St. Mary's Catholic Church, 1706 West Main St., Belleville, Ill.

Funeral: A Mass of Christian Burial will be celebrated at 1 p.m. Thursday, Aug. 19, 2010, at St. Mary's Catholic Church, Belleville, Ill., with Monsignor William McGhee officiating. Burial will be at Green Mount Catholic Cemetery, Belleville, Ill.
